Your LVR (Loan-to-Value Ratio) represents the amount you are borrowing as a percentage of the property’s value. When you capitalise LMI into your loan, your LVR increases.

A guarantor is a person (usually a family member) who agrees to take legal responsibility for your loan if you fail to make your repayments. This comparison rate applies only to the example or examples given. Different amounts and terms will result in different comparison rates. Costs such as redraw fees or early repayment fees, and cost savings such as fee waivers, are not included in the comparison rate but may influence the cost of the loan. The comparison rate displayed is based on a loan of $150,000 over a term of 25 years. Low deposit home loans work by allowing you to borrow more 95% of the property value, meaning your Loan-To-Value Ratio (LVR) is high. Because of this higher risk, lenders require borrowers to pay Lenders Mortgage Insurance (LMI).

Because a low deposit means you are taking on a larger loan, your monthly repayments will be higher. Therefore, you must demonstrate strong serviceability, meaning your income comfortably covers the higher debt obligations alongside your living expenses. Typically, these loans start with a 5% deposit through standard lenders, but can go as low as 2% or even 0% for eligible borrowers using government-backed schemes or guarantor support. Some lenders may allow you to borrow up to 100% of a property’s value with a guarantor home loan. Commonly referred to as a ‘no deposit home loan’, this type of product typically comes with strict conditions. One key requirement is that the guarantor must usually be an immediate adult family member.
